USB Modem / Huawei E220 on Vista. Finally.
UPDATE: please see this post for the latest Vista updates.
Well it looks like there’s finally a solution for Vista users who’ve been stranded without connectivity due to the incompatibility of the USB Modem (the VF branded Huawei E220). We’ve managed to get the required updates – the only caveat at this point is that you’ll need to run them on a non-vista machine, before then plugging your newly flashed device back into your vista box.
This fix is only for the 32bit edition of Vista, 64bit drivers are on the way…
Here’s what you need to do:
- Find a Windows 2000 / XP machine. If you’ve plugged the USB modem into it before, go into control panel, then add remove & programs then de-install the Vodafone runtime components.
- Plug the USB Modem back into this machine. The EULA should pop up, click on cancel – this will stop the software loading.
- Now, you need to update the firmware – this will allow the device to be recognised by Windows Vista without it throwing a fit. Download this executable and run it.
- Almost there. Now it’s time to update the software / dashboard on the device to the latest version – this will also give you long-awaited SMS functionality. Download this executable and run it. When I ran it, it threw up an error message saying ‘firmware not response’ at the end of the update, but it still works ok.
That’s it! Your USB modem is now up to date with the latest firmware and software and can now be used with Windows Vista. You might want to do this even if you’re not running Vista as the latest software gives you SMS support, PIN support plus a few other fixes.

fatcat
That’s the way the plug and play feature works on the USB modem. It’s recognised by windows as both a mass storage device / cd drive, plus also a modem. The ‘virtual’ CD drive contains all the software required – i.e. the device drivers and the dashboard.

hin nimah…
Frst check and see
if the modem flashing green or blue..
green—> no network or sim card not set properly..
blue—-> good and proceed further…..
if u have service Pack 1 or 2 installed for ur XP, if less than 2 i dont think the E220 is compatble…
if SP2 and E220 not getting detected…
check the drivers..
ie through
right click on my computer—>properties—–>hardware——> device manager…
there are 4 Huwaei drivers..
1. under dvc/cd rom drives’
2. under modems
3. under ports
4. under universal bus controller
if any of the drivers are missing or showing a yellow/red exclamation mark then its time u install the drivers manually(check with ur service provider tech team if unsure)
if all drivers present then create a dialup connection( which again u will need to get in touch with ur service provider as u need the tel no… and the APN no…for ur service provider)…
check if this helps

Vodafone’s femtocell won’t improve mobile broadband
Vodafone UK have just announced the availability of thier new “3G coverage booster”, aka a 3G femtocell. This little box of tricks plugs into your home broadband connection and routes calls over the internet and onto Voda’s network. This is welcome news for those of us with 3G handsets who are unable to access data services or make reliable voice calls due to poor coverage.
However, it’s not great news for mobile broadband users. Although it’s unclear if the femtocell supports higher speed technology (HSDPA), the fact that it routes the data over your ADSL connection should be enough reason to rule it out. If you’ve got ADSL at home, why bother using your mobile broadband allowance when fixed line is far cheaper and faster?
